HOW TO HEAT TREAT FLOUR - SHUGARY SWEETS
May 05, 2021 · Heat oven to 350 degrees F.;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per and spread a thing layer of flour on the cookies sheet (or the exact amount you need for your recipe).; Bake flour for about 5 minutes and use a food thermometer to check the temperature. It should read 160 degrees. If it’s not quite hot enough yet, give it another minute and check again.

HOW TO HEAT TREAT FLOUR FOR RAW COOKIE DOUGH - HABUKI COOKIE
Apr 02, 2021 · To heat treat flour in the microwave, place the flour in a large (soup) bowl. Heat it in 30-second intervals until the flour temperature reaches 165 F (74 C). Mix with a spoon in-between intervals. Each microwave is different, but mine take around 3 intervals. To heat treat flour in the oven, start your oven at 300 F (150 C).

HEAT TREATED FLOUR | BAKING INGREDIENTS | BAKERPEDIA
Heat treated flour, heated between 210°F to 230°F for 60 minutes, can extend shelf life, increase volume of cakes, and create a fine even grain in products. It is characterized by its ability to absorb moisture and the inability of its protein content to form gluten when the flour is hydrated.

HOW TO MAKE BAKED FLOUR THAT'S SAFE TO EAT RAW - CRAZY FOR ...
Mar 06, 2021 · 1. Preheat the oven to 350°F. 2. Spread the amount of flour you need for your recipe on a cookie sheet. 3. Once the oven is heated, bake the flour for five minutes. 4. Cool it on the sheet before adding it to your recipe. Tip: You can bake flour ahead of time.
